Hello everybody, i'm vyas, from kerala. Got my new fazer black, one week ago. Professionally i'm a doctor, and been a bike enthusiast ever since i started my college, but could own one only after that golden period. I was invited to this forum by a hardcore xbhpian, praveen from mundakayam,kerala, a very good friend of mine.
So, about my machine, i'm really happy with him. Actually i was bit confused wth 220 and fazer, i mean both are too good. When i asked praveen for an opinion, he asked just one question, u want a tourer or a power bike? So the choice was simple. Those guys frm kerala would know we don't 've that good roads in kerala, to unleash the power of 220. Instead we've d curvy roads, its another experience to speak of in fact.. And really he's amazingly stable. I've driven pulsar a lot of times through these roads, never felt this confidence. I'l post more about my experiments with ride, soon. Welcome My Friend's Friend

Congratz on your purchase.You are very true- pulsars will not match the stability of Fz/fazor on corners. Bajaj never worked on mass centralization. The frame is not rigid either.But u can surely unleash the power of 220 on our highways though. Torque is torque. You will feel the need for extra power only when u do the longest of your rides.In that case ZMR will make better sense.
